/* ------------------------------------------------------------------------
*
* utility_stmt_hooking.c
* Override COPY TO/FROM and ALTER TABLE ... RENAME statements
* for partitioned tables
*
* Copyright (c) 2016-2020, Postgres Professional
* Portions Copyright (c) 1996-2015, PostgreSQL Global Development Group
* Portions Copyright (c) 1994, Regents of the University of California
*
* ------------------------------------------------------------------------
*/
#include "compat/debug_compat_features.h"
#include "compat/pg_compat.h"
#include "init.h"
#include "utility_stmt_hooking.h"
#include "partition_filter.h"
#include "access/htup_details.h"
#if PG_VERSION_NUM >= 120000
#include "access/heapam.h"
#include "access/table.h"
#endif
#include "access/sysattr.h"
#include "access/xact.h"
#include "catalog/namespace.h"
#include "commands/copy.h"
#if PG_VERSION_NUM >= 160000 /* for commit a61b1f74823c */
#include "commands/copyfrom_internal.h"
#endif
#include "commands/defrem.h"
#include "commands/trigger.h"
#include "commands/tablecmds.h"
#include "foreign/fdwapi.h"
#include "miscadmin.h"
#include "nodes/makefuncs.h"
#if PG_VERSION_NUM >= 160000 /* for commit a61b1f74823c */
#include "parser/parse_relation.h"
#endif
#include "utils/builtins.h"
#include "utils/lsyscache.h"
#include "utils/memutils.h"
#include "utils/rls.h"
/* we avoid includig libpq.h because it requires openssl.h */
#include "libpq/pqcomm.h"
extern PGDLLIMPORT ProtocolVersion FrontendProtocol;
extern void pq_endmsgread(void);
/* Determine whether we should enable COPY or not (PostgresPro has a fix) */
#if defined(WIN32) && \
(!defined(ENABLE_PGPRO_PATCHES) || \
!defined(ENABLE_PATHMAN_AWARE_COPY_WIN32) || \
!defined(PGPRO_PATHMAN_AWARE_COPY))
#define DISABLE_PATHMAN_COPY
#endif
/*
* While building PostgreSQL on Windows the msvc compiler produces .def file
* which contains all the symbols that were declared as external except the ones
* that were declared but not defined. We redefine variables below to prevent
* 'unresolved symbol' errors on Windows. But we have to disable COPY feature
* on Windows.
*/
#ifdef DISABLE_PATHMAN_COPY
bool XactReadOnly = false;
ProtocolVersion FrontendProtocol = (ProtocolVersion) 0;
#endif
#define PATHMAN_COPY_READ_LOCK AccessShareLock
#define PATHMAN_COPY_WRITE_LOCK RowExclusiveLock
static uint64 PathmanCopyFrom(
#if PG_VERSION_NUM >= 140000 /* Structure changed in c532d15dddff */
CopyFromState cstate,
#else
CopyState cstate,
#endif
Relation parent_rel,
List *range_table,
bool old_protocol);
static void prepare_rri_for_copy(ResultRelInfoHolder *rri_holder,
const ResultPartsStorage *rps_storage);
static void finish_rri_for_copy(ResultRelInfoHolder *rri_holder,
const ResultPartsStorage *rps_storage);
/*
* Is pg_pathman supposed to handle this COPY stmt?
*/
bool
is_pathman_related_copy(Node *parsetree)
{
CopyStmt *copy_stmt = (CopyStmt *) parsetree;
Oid parent_relid;
Assert(IsPathmanReady());
if (!IsOverrideCopyEnabled())
{
elog(DEBUG1, "COPY statement hooking is disabled");
return false;
}
/* Check that it's a CopyStmt */
if (!IsA(parsetree, CopyStmt))
return false;
/* Also check that stmt->relation exists */
if (!copy_stmt->relation)
return false;
/* Get partition's Oid while locking it */
parent_relid = RangeVarGetRelid(copy_stmt->relation,
(copy_stmt->is_from ?
PATHMAN_COPY_WRITE_LOCK :
PATHMAN_COPY_READ_LOCK),
true);
/* Skip relation if it does not exist (for Citus compatibility) */
if (!OidIsValid(parent_relid))
return false;
/* Check that relation is partitioned */
if (has_pathman_relation_info(parent_relid))
{
ListCell *lc;
/* Analyze options list */
foreach (lc, copy_stmt->options)
{
DefElem *defel = (DefElem *) lfirst(lc);
/* We do not support freeze */
/*
* It would be great to allow copy.c extract option value and
* check it ready. However, there is no possibility (hooks) to do
* that before messaging 'ok, begin streaming data' to the client,
* which is ugly and confusing: e.g. it would require us to
* actually send something in regression tests before we notice
* the error.
*/
if (strcmp(defel->defname, "freeze") == 0 && defGetBoolean(defel))
elog(ERROR, "freeze is not supported for partitioned tables");
}
/* Emit ERROR if we can't see the necessary symbols */
#ifdef DISABLE_PATHMAN_COPY
elog(ERROR, "COPY is not supported for partitioned tables on Windows");
#else
elog(DEBUG1, "Overriding default behavior for COPY [%u]",
parent_relid);
#endif
return true;
}
return false;
}
/*
* Is pg_pathman supposed to handle this table rename stmt?
*/
bool
is_pathman_related_table_rename(Node *parsetree,
Oid *relation_oid_out, /* ret value #1 */
bool *is_parent_out) /* ret value #2 */
{
RenameStmt *rename_stmt = (RenameStmt *) parsetree;
Oid relation_oid,
parent_relid;
Assert(IsPathmanReady());
/* Set default values */
if (relation_oid_out) *relation_oid_out = InvalidOid;
if (!IsA(parsetree, RenameStmt))
return false;
/* Are we going to rename some table? */
if (rename_stmt->renameType != OBJECT_TABLE)
return false;
/* Fetch Oid of this relation */
relation_oid = RangeVarGetRelid(rename_stmt->relation,
AccessShareLock,
rename_stmt->missing_ok);
/* Check ALTER TABLE ... IF EXISTS of nonexistent table */
if (rename_stmt->missing_ok && relation_oid == InvalidOid)
return false;
/* Assume it's a parent */
if (has_pathman_relation_info(relation_oid))
{
if (relation_oid_out)
*relation_oid_out = relation_oid;
if (is_parent_out)
*is_parent_out = true;
return true;
}
/* Assume it's a partition, fetch its parent */
parent_relid = get_parent_of_partition(relation_oid);
if (!OidIsValid(parent_relid))
return false;
/* Is parent partitioned? */
if (has_pathman_relation_info(parent_relid))
{
if (relation_oid_out)
*relation_oid_out = relation_oid;
if (is_parent_out)
*is_parent_out = false;
return true;
}
return false;
}
/*
* Is pg_pathman supposed to handle this ALTER COLUMN TYPE stmt?
*/
bool
is_pathman_related_alter_column_type(Node *parsetree,
Oid *parent_relid_out,
AttrNumber *attr_number_out,
PartType *part_type_out)
{
AlterTableStmt *alter_table_stmt = (AlterTableStmt *) parsetree;
ListCell *lc;
Oid parent_relid;
bool result = false;
PartRelationInfo *prel;
Assert(IsPathmanReady());
if (!IsA(alter_table_stmt, AlterTableStmt))
return false;
/* Are we going to modify some table? */
#if PG_VERSION_NUM >= 140000
if (alter_table_stmt->objtype != OBJECT_TABLE)
#else
if (alter_table_stmt->relkind != OBJECT_TABLE)
#endif
return false;
/* Assume it's a parent, fetch its Oid */
parent_relid = RangeVarGetRelid(alter_table_stmt->relation,
AccessShareLock,
alter_table_stmt->missing_ok);
/* Check ALTER TABLE ... IF EXISTS of nonexistent table */
if (alter_table_stmt->missing_ok && parent_relid == InvalidOid)
return false;
/* Is parent partitioned? */
if ((prel = get_pathman_relation_info(parent_relid)) != NULL)
{
/* Return 'parent_relid' and 'prel->parttype' */
if (parent_relid_out) *parent_relid_out = parent_relid;
if (part_type_out) *part_type_out = prel->parttype;
}
else return false;
/* Examine command list */
foreach (lc, alter_table_stmt->cmds)
{
AlterTableCmd *alter_table_cmd = (AlterTableCmd *) lfirst(lc);
AttrNumber attnum;
int adjusted_attnum;
if (!IsA(alter_table_cmd, AlterTableCmd))
continue;
/* Is it an ALTER COLUMN TYPE statement? */
if (alter_table_cmd->subtype != AT_AlterColumnType)
continue;
/* Is it a column that used in expression? */
attnum = get_attnum(parent_relid, alter_table_cmd->name);
adjusted_attnum = attnum - FirstLowInvalidHeapAttributeNumber;
if (!bms_is_member(adjusted_attnum, prel->expr_atts))
continue;
/* Return 'attr_number_out' if asked to */
if (attr_number_out) *attr_number_out = attnum;
/* Success! */
result = true;
}
close_pathman_relation_info(prel);
return result;
}
/*
* PathmanCopyGetAttnums - build an integer list of attnums to be copied
*
* The input attnamelist is either the user-specified column list,
* or NIL if there was none (in which case we want all the non-dropped
* columns).
*
* rel can be NULL ... it's only used for error reports.
*/
static List *
PathmanCopyGetAttnums(TupleDesc tupDesc, Relation rel, List *attnamelist)
{
List *attnums = NIL;
if (attnamelist == NIL)
{
/* Generate default column list */
int attr_count = tupDesc->natts;
int i;
for (i = 0; i < attr_count; i++)
{
if (TupleDescAttr(tupDesc, i)->attisdropped)
continue;
attnums = lappend_int(attnums, i + 1);
}
}
else
{
/* Validate the user-supplied list and extract attnums */
ListCell *l;
foreach(l, attnamelist)
{
char *name = strVal(lfirst(l));
int attnum;
int i;
/* Lookup column name */
attnum = InvalidAttrNumber;
for (i = 0; i < tupDesc->natts; i++)
{
Form_pg_attribute att = TupleDescAttr(tupDesc, i);
if (att->attisdropped)
continue;
if (namestrcmp(&(att->attname), name) == 0)
{
attnum = att->attnum;
break;
}
}
if (attnum == InvalidAttrNumber)
{
if (rel != NULL)
ereport(ERROR,
(errcode(ERRCODE_UNDEFINED_COLUMN),
errmsg("column \"%s\" of relation \"%s\" does not exist",
name, RelationGetRelationName(rel))));
else
ereport(ERROR,
(errcode(ERRCODE_UNDEFINED_COLUMN),
errmsg("column \"%s\" does not exist",
name)));
}
/* Check for duplicates */
if (list_member_int(attnums, attnum))
ereport(ERROR,
(errcode(ERRCODE_DUPLICATE_COLUMN),
errmsg("column \"%s\" specified more than once",
name)));
attnums = lappend_int(attnums, attnum);
}
}
return attnums;
}
/*
* Execute COPY TO/FROM statement for a partitioned table.
* NOTE: based on DoCopy() (see copy.c).
*/
void
PathmanDoCopy(const CopyStmt *stmt,
const char *queryString,
int stmt_location,
int stmt_len,
uint64 *processed)
{
#if PG_VERSION_NUM >= 140000 /* Structure changed in c532d15dddff */
CopyFromState cstate;
#else
CopyState cstate;
#endif
ParseState *pstate;
Relation rel;
List *range_table = NIL;
bool is_from = stmt->is_from,
pipe = (stmt->filename == NULL),
is_old_protocol = PG_PROTOCOL_MAJOR(FrontendProtocol) < 3 && pipe;
/* Disallow COPY TO/FROM file or program except to superusers. */
if (!pipe && !superuser())
{
if (stmt->is_program)
ereport(ERROR,
(errcode(ERRCODE_INSUFFICIENT_PRIVILEGE),
errmsg("must be superuser to COPY to or from an external program"),
errhint("Anyone can COPY to stdout or from stdin. "
"psql's \\copy command also works for anyone.")));
else
ereport(ERROR,
(errcode(ERRCODE_INSUFFICIENT_PRIVILEGE),
errmsg("must be superuser to COPY to or from a file"),
errhint("Anyone can COPY to stdout or from stdin. "
"psql's \\copy command also works for anyone.")));
}
pstate = make_parsestate(NULL);
pstate->p_sourcetext = queryString;
/* Check that we have a relation */
if (stmt->relation)
{
TupleDesc tupDesc;
AclMode required_access = (is_from ? ACL_INSERT : ACL_SELECT);
List *attnums;
ListCell *cur;
RangeTblEntry *rte;
#if PG_VERSION_NUM >= 160000 /* for commit a61b1f74823c */
RTEPermissionInfo *perminfo;
#endif
Assert(!stmt->query);
/* Open the relation (we've locked it in is_pathman_related_copy()) */
rel = heap_openrv_compat(stmt->relation, NoLock);
rte = makeNode(RangeTblEntry);
rte->rtekind = RTE_RELATION;
rte->relid = RelationGetRelid(rel);
rte->relkind = rel->rd_rel->relkind;
#if PG_VERSION_NUM >= 160000 /* for commit a61b1f74823c */
pstate->p_rtable = lappend(pstate->p_rtable, rte);
perminfo = addRTEPermissionInfo(&pstate->p_rteperminfos, rte);
perminfo->requiredPerms = required_access;
#else
rte->requiredPerms = required_access;
#endif
range_table = list_make1(rte);
tupDesc = RelationGetDescr(rel);
attnums = PathmanCopyGetAttnums(tupDesc, rel, stmt->attlist);
#if PG_VERSION_NUM >= 160000 /* for commit a61b1f74823c */
foreach(cur, attnums)
{
int attno;
Bitmapset **bms;
attno = lfirst_int(cur) - FirstLowInvalidHeapAttributeNumber;
bms = is_from ? &perminfo->insertedCols : &perminfo->selectedCols;
*bms = bms_add_member(*bms, attno);
}
ExecCheckPermissions(pstate->p_rtable, list_make1(perminfo), true);
#else
foreach(cur, attnums)
{
int attnum = lfirst_int(cur) - FirstLowInvalidHeapAttributeNumber;
if (is_from)
rte->insertedCols = bms_add_member(rte->insertedCols, attnum);
else
rte->selectedCols = bms_add_member(rte->selectedCols, attnum);
}
ExecCheckRTPerms(range_table, true);
#endif
/* Disable COPY FROM if table has RLS */
if (is_from && check_enable_rls(rte->relid, InvalidOid, false) == RLS_ENABLED)
{
ereport(ERROR,
(errcode(ERRCODE_FEATURE_NOT_SUPPORTED),
errmsg("COPY FROM not supported with row-level security"),
errhint("Use INSERT statements instead.")));
}
/* Disable COPY TO */
if (!is_from)
{
ereport(WARNING,
(errmsg("COPY TO will only select rows from parent table \"%s\"",
RelationGetRelationName(rel)),
errhint("Consider using the COPY (SELECT ...) TO variant.")));
}
}
/* This should never happen (see is_pathman_related_copy()) */
else elog(ERROR, "error in function " CppAsString(PathmanDoCopy));
if (is_from)
{
/* check read-only transaction and parallel mode */
if (XactReadOnly && !rel->rd_islocaltemp)
PreventCommandIfReadOnly("COPY FROM");
PreventCommandIfParallelMode("COPY FROM");
cstate = BeginCopyFromCompat(pstate, rel, stmt->filename,
stmt->is_program, NULL, stmt->attlist,
stmt->options);
*processed = PathmanCopyFrom(cstate, rel, range_table, is_old_protocol);
EndCopyFrom(cstate);
}
else
{
#if PG_VERSION_NUM >= 160000 /* for commit f75cec4fff87 */
/*
* Forget current RangeTblEntries and RTEPermissionInfos.
* Standard DoCopy will create new ones.
*/
pstate->p_rtable = NULL;
pstate->p_rteperminfos = NULL;
#endif
/* Call standard DoCopy using a new CopyStmt */
DoCopyCompat(pstate, stmt, stmt_location, stmt_len, processed);
}
/* Close the relation, but keep it locked */
heap_close_compat(rel, (is_from ? NoLock : PATHMAN_COPY_READ_LOCK));
}
/*
* Copy FROM file to relation.
*/
static uint64
PathmanCopyFrom(
#if PG_VERSION_NUM >= 140000 /* Structure changed in c532d15dddff */
CopyFromState cstate,
#else
CopyState cstate,
#endif
Relation parent_rel,
List *range_table, bool old_protocol)
{
HeapTuple tuple;
TupleDesc tupDesc;
Datum *values;
bool *nulls;
ResultPartsStorage parts_storage;
ResultRelInfo *parent_rri;
Oid parent_relid = RelationGetRelid(parent_rel);
MemoryContext query_mcxt = CurrentMemoryContext;
EState *estate = CreateExecutorState(); /* for ExecConstraints() */
TupleTableSlot *myslot;
uint64 processed = 0;
tupDesc = RelationGetDescr(parent_rel);
parent_rri = makeNode(ResultRelInfo);
InitResultRelInfoCompat(parent_rri,
parent_rel,
1, /* dummy rangetable index */
0);
ExecOpenIndices(parent_rri, false);
#if PG_VERSION_NUM >= 140000 /* reworked in 1375422c7826 */
/*
* Call ExecInitRangeTable() should be first because in 14+ it initializes
* field "estate->es_result_relations":
*/
#if PG_VERSION_NUM >= 160000
ExecInitRangeTable(estate, range_table, cstate->rteperminfos);
#else
ExecInitRangeTable(estate, range_table);
#endif
estate->es_result_relations =
(ResultRelInfo **) palloc0(list_length(range_table) * sizeof(ResultRelInfo *));
estate->es_result_relations[0] = parent_rri;
/*
* Saving in the list allows to avoid needlessly traversing the whole
* array when only a few of its entries are possibly non-NULL.
*/
estate->es_opened_result_relations =
lappend(estate->es_opened_result_relations, parent_rri);
estate->es_result_relation_info = parent_rri;
#else
estate->es_result_relations = parent_rri;
estate->es_num_result_relations = 1;
estate->es_result_relation_info = parent_rri;
#if PG_VERSION_NUM >= 120000
ExecInitRangeTable(estate, range_table);
#else
estate->es_range_table = range_table;
#endif
#endif
/* Initialize ResultPartsStorage */
init_result_parts_storage(&parts_storage,
parent_relid, parent_rri,
estate, CMD_INSERT,
RPS_CLOSE_RELATIONS,
RPS_DEFAULT_SPECULATIVE,
RPS_RRI_CB(prepare_rri_for_copy, cstate),
RPS_RRI_CB(finish_rri_for_copy, NULL));
#if PG_VERSION_NUM >= 160000 /* for commit a61b1f74823c */
/* ResultRelInfo of partitioned table. */
parts_storage.init_rri = parent_rri;
/*
* Copy the RTEPermissionInfos into estate as well, so that
* scan_result_parts_storage() et al will work correctly.
*/
estate->es_rteperminfos = cstate->rteperminfos;
#endif
/* Set up a tuple slot too */
myslot = ExecInitExtraTupleSlotCompat(estate, NULL, &TTSOpsHeapTuple);
/* Triggers might need a slot as well */
#if PG_VERSION_NUM < 120000
estate->es_trig_tuple_slot = ExecInitExtraTupleSlotCompat(estate, tupDesc, nothing_here);
#endif
/* Prepare to catch AFTER triggers. */
AfterTriggerBeginQuery();
/*
* Check BEFORE STATEMENT insertion triggers. It's debatable whether we
* should do this for COPY, since it's not really an "INSERT" statement as
* such. However, executing these triggers maintains consistency with the
* EACH ROW triggers that we already fire on COPY.
*/
ExecBSInsertTriggers(estate, parent_rri);
values = (Datum *) palloc(tupDesc->natts * sizeof(Datum));
nulls = (bool *) palloc(tupDesc->natts * sizeof(bool));
for (;;)
{
TupleTableSlot *slot;
bool skip_tuple = false;
#if PG_VERSION_NUM < 120000
Oid tuple_oid = InvalidOid;
#endif
ExprContext *econtext = GetPerTupleExprContext(estate);
ResultRelInfoHolder *rri_holder;
ResultRelInfo *child_rri;
CHECK_FOR_INTERRUPTS();
ResetPerTupleExprContext(estate);
/* Switch into per tuple memory context */
MemoryContextSwitchTo(GetPerTupleMemoryContext(estate));
if (!NextCopyFromCompat(cstate, econtext, values, nulls, &tuple_oid))
break;
/* We can form the input tuple */
tuple = heap_form_tuple(tupDesc, values, nulls);
#if PG_VERSION_NUM < 120000
if (tuple_oid != InvalidOid)
HeapTupleSetOid(tuple, tuple_oid);
#endif
/* Place tuple in tuple slot --- but slot shouldn't free it */
slot = myslot;
ExecSetSlotDescriptor(slot, tupDesc);
#if PG_VERSION_NUM >= 120000
ExecStoreHeapTuple(tuple, slot, false);
#else
ExecStoreTuple(tuple, slot, InvalidBuffer, false);
#endif
/* Search for a matching partition */
rri_holder = select_partition_for_insert(estate, &parts_storage, slot);
child_rri = rri_holder->result_rel_info;
/* Magic: replace parent's ResultRelInfo with ours */
estate->es_result_relation_info = child_rri;
/*
* Constraints might reference the tableoid column, so initialize
* t_tableOid before evaluating them.
*/
tuple->t_tableOid = RelationGetRelid(child_rri->ri_RelationDesc);
/* If there's a transform map, rebuild the tuple */
if (rri_holder->tuple_map)
{
HeapTuple tuple_old;
tuple_old = tuple;
#if PG_VERSION_NUM >= 120000
tuple = execute_attr_map_tuple(tuple, rri_holder->tuple_map);
#else
tuple = do_convert_tuple(tuple, rri_holder->tuple_map);
#endif
heap_freetuple(tuple_old);
}
/* Now we can set proper tuple descriptor according to child relation */
ExecSetSlotDescriptor(slot, RelationGetDescr(child_rri->ri_RelationDesc));
#if PG_VERSION_NUM >= 120000
ExecStoreHeapTuple(tuple, slot, false);
#else
ExecStoreTuple(tuple, slot, InvalidBuffer, false);
#endif
/* Triggers and stuff need to be invoked in query context. */
MemoryContextSwitchTo(query_mcxt);
/* BEFORE ROW INSERT Triggers */
if (child_rri->ri_TrigDesc &&
child_rri->ri_TrigDesc->trig_insert_before_row)
{
#if PG_VERSION_NUM >= 120000
if (!ExecBRInsertTriggers(estate, child_rri, slot))
skip_tuple = true;
else /* trigger might have changed tuple */
tuple = ExecFetchSlotHeapTuple(slot, false, NULL);
#else
slot = ExecBRInsertTriggers(estate, child_rri, slot);
if (slot == NULL) /* "do nothing" */
skip_tuple = true;
else /* trigger might have changed tuple */
{
tuple = ExecMaterializeSlot(slot);
}
#endif
}
/* Proceed if we still have a tuple */
if (!skip_tuple)
{
List *recheckIndexes = NIL;
/* Check the constraints of the tuple */
if (child_rri->ri_RelationDesc->rd_att->constr)
ExecConstraints(child_rri, slot, estate);
/* Handle local tables */
if (!child_rri->ri_FdwRoutine)
{
/* OK, now store the tuple... */
simple_heap_insert(child_rri->ri_RelationDesc, tuple);
#if PG_VERSION_NUM >= 120000 /* since 12, tid lives directly in slot */
ItemPointerCopy(&tuple->t_self, &slot->tts_tid);
/* and we must stamp tableOid as we go around table_tuple_insert */
slot->tts_tableOid = RelationGetRelid(child_rri->ri_RelationDesc);
#endif
/* ... and create index entries for it */
if (child_rri->ri_NumIndices > 0)
recheckIndexes = ExecInsertIndexTuplesCompat(estate->es_result_relation_info,
slot, &(tuple->t_self), estate, false, false, NULL, NIL, false);
}
#ifdef PG_SHARDMAN
/* Handle foreign tables */
else
{
child_rri->ri_FdwRoutine->ForeignNextCopyFrom(estate,
child_rri,
cstate);
}
#endif
/* AFTER ROW INSERT Triggers (FIXME: NULL transition) */
#if PG_VERSION_NUM >= 120000
ExecARInsertTriggersCompat(estate, child_rri, slot,
recheckIndexes, NULL);
#else
ExecARInsertTriggersCompat(estate, child_rri, tuple,
recheckIndexes, NULL);
#endif
list_free(recheckIndexes);
/*
* We count only tuples not suppressed by a BEFORE INSERT trigger;
* this is the same definition used by execMain.c for counting
* tuples inserted by an INSERT command.
*/
processed++;
}
}
/* Switch back to query context */
MemoryContextSwitchTo(query_mcxt);
/* Required for old protocol */
if (old_protocol)
pq_endmsgread();
/* Execute AFTER STATEMENT insertion triggers (FIXME: NULL transition) */
ExecASInsertTriggersCompat(estate, parent_rri, NULL);
/* Handle queued AFTER triggers */
AfterTriggerEndQuery(estate);
pfree(values);
pfree(nulls);
/* Release resources for tuple table */
ExecResetTupleTable(estate->es_tupleTable, false);
/* Close partitions and destroy hash table */
fini_result_parts_storage(&parts_storage);
/* Close parent's indices */
ExecCloseIndices(parent_rri);
/* Release an EState along with all remaining working storage */
FreeExecutorState(estate);
return processed;
}
/*
* Init COPY FROM, if supported.
*/
static void
prepare_rri_for_copy(ResultRelInfoHolder *rri_holder,
const ResultPartsStorage *rps_storage)
{
ResultRelInfo *rri = rri_holder->result_rel_info;
FdwRoutine *fdw_routine = rri->ri_FdwRoutine;
if (fdw_routine != NULL)
{
/*
* If this PostgreSQL edition has no idea about shardman, behave as usual:
* vanilla Postgres doesn't support COPY FROM to foreign partitions.
* However, shardman patches to core extend FDW API to allow it.
*/
#ifdef PG_SHARDMAN
/* shardman COPY FROM requested? */
if (*find_rendezvous_variable(
"shardman_pathman_copy_from_rendezvous") != NULL &&
FdwCopyFromIsSupported(fdw_routine))
{
CopyState cstate = (CopyState) rps_storage->init_rri_holder_cb_arg;
ResultRelInfo *parent_rri = rps_storage->base_rri;
EState *estate = rps_storage->estate;
fdw_routine->BeginForeignCopyFrom(estate, rri, cstate, parent_rri);
return;
}
#endif
elog(ERROR, "cannot copy to foreign partition \"%s\"",
get_rel_name(RelationGetRelid(rri->ri_RelationDesc)));
}
}
/*
* Shutdown FDWs.
*/
static void
finish_rri_for_copy(ResultRelInfoHolder *rri_holder,
const ResultPartsStorage *rps_storage)
{
#ifdef PG_SHARDMAN
ResultRelInfo *resultRelInfo = rri_holder->result_rel_info;
if (resultRelInfo->ri_FdwRoutine)
resultRelInfo->ri_FdwRoutine->EndForeignCopyFrom(rps_storage->estate,
resultRelInfo);
#endif
}
/*
* Rename RANGE\HASH check constraint of a partition on table rename event.
*/
void
PathmanRenameConstraint(Oid partition_relid, /* partition Oid */
const RenameStmt *rename_stmt) /* partition rename stmt */
{
char *old_constraint_name,
*new_constraint_name;
RenameStmt rename_con_stmt;
/* Generate old constraint name */
old_constraint_name =
build_check_constraint_name_relid_internal(partition_relid);
/* Generate new constraint name */
new_constraint_name =
build_check_constraint_name_relname_internal(rename_stmt->newname);
/* Build check constraint RENAME statement */
memset((void *) &rename_con_stmt, 0, sizeof(RenameStmt));
NodeSetTag(&rename_con_stmt, T_RenameStmt);
rename_con_stmt.renameType = OBJECT_TABCONSTRAINT;
rename_con_stmt.relation = rename_stmt->relation;
rename_con_stmt.subname = old_constraint_name;
rename_con_stmt.newname = new_constraint_name;
rename_con_stmt.missing_ok = false;
/* Finally, rename partitioning constraint */
RenameConstraint(&rename_con_stmt);
pfree(old_constraint_name);
pfree(new_constraint_name);
/* Make changes visible */
CommandCounterIncrement();
}
/*
* Rename auto naming sequence of a parent on table rename event.
*/
void
PathmanRenameSequence(Oid parent_relid, /* parent Oid */
const RenameStmt *rename_stmt) /* parent rename stmt */
{
char *old_seq_name,
*new_seq_name,
*seq_nsp_name;
RangeVar *seq_rv;
Oid seq_relid;
/* Produce old & new names and RangeVar */
seq_nsp_name = get_namespace_name(get_rel_namespace(parent_relid));
old_seq_name = build_sequence_name_relid_internal(parent_relid);
new_seq_name = build_sequence_name_relname_internal(rename_stmt->newname);
seq_rv = makeRangeVar(seq_nsp_name, old_seq_name, -1);
/* Fetch Oid of sequence */
seq_relid = RangeVarGetRelid(seq_rv, AccessExclusiveLock, true);
/* Do nothing if there's no naming sequence */
if (!OidIsValid(seq_relid))
return;
/* Finally, rename auto naming sequence */
RenameRelationInternalCompat(seq_relid, new_seq_name, false, false);
pfree(seq_nsp_name);
pfree(old_seq_name);
pfree(new_seq_name);
pfree(seq_rv);
/* Make changes visible */
CommandCounterIncrement();
}
